dissimilar Ways to Get Children to Interact With Each Other

If you are the owner or employee of a day-care centre, with a estimate of different age groups, or if your own children have quite a large age gap between them then you will know how difficult it can be to plan for all of them, it can be difficult but not impossible.

You could plan for events where every person can join in regardless of their age or talent, or you could plan something where the older kids can look after the younger ones.

There are quite a few ways to involve every person in the activities, especially during the summer months.

You could take all the kids outdoors and let them have a free reign in a craft classes; you just have to contribute the materials and then let them do the rest, it should be spirited to see the different talent on show from the different age groups.

Just give the kids a few beginning instructions and let them use their own thoughts to originate their pieces of artwork, you will be surprised at how better they accomplish once the restrictions are lifted, and they are free to express themselves without having to be told what to do.

You could let every person participate in a game of tag, every person of all ages can play this, and it will also exercise the kids as well as yourself should you wish to join in the game.

Find games where the older children can look after the younger ones, this sense of responsibility will help them to understand their responsibilities, and give them more confidence for their roles in later life.
You could also let the younger children and the older children do what they want at times, or vary the events and activities, it can be good for the children and give them a tiny bit of freedom
